Inclusion criteria

Inclusion criteria: Diagnosis of a distal radius fracture with indication for conservative treatment. All patients > 50 years of age are included in the study, both genders are considered.

Exclusion criteria

Exclusion criteria: Contraindications for performing an MRI.

Design outcomes

Primary

MeasureTime frame
Muscle fat and muscle atrophy are to be assessed in MRI scans as primary radiological endpoints. The somatotropic, gonadotropic, and corticotropic axes are to be evaluated as primary endocrinological endpoints.

Secondary

MeasureTime frame
Sarcopenia, osteoporosis, and obesity are to be quantified as secondary clinical endpoints.
